A handbell rings out across the frosty market signalling the
start of the first pre-Christmas auction of holly and mistletoe at
Tenbury Wells in Shropshire. Local farmers and growers in trilby
hats mingle with city types in wax jackets; families of gypsies
watch to see what their entries will make; children, who
traditionally bunk off school for this first sale, run about
exhilarated in the crisp air - for everyone this sale marks the
beginning of Christmas.
